Team GB's Kyle Edmund has been knocked out of the Olympics after losing his second-round clash to Japan's Taro Daniel in Rio de Janeiro on Monday.

The Davis Cup winner was beaten 6-4 7-5 by Daniel, who has never progressed past the second round in a major tournament.

It was a positive start from the Brit as he went an early break up, but Daniel bounced back to break twice and give himself a one-set lead in 44 minutes.

Edmund tried to recover by saving two break points in the second set and immediately snatched serve, but Daniel answered the threat and managed to wrap up the set in just less than an hour.

Britain's sole hope in the men's singles is with Andy Murray, who will face Juan Monaco in the second round.
